ICSE Class 10 Physics Topic-Wise Weightage Distribution 2025

ISCE board does not provide any particular marks weightage for a chapter. However, based on the previous sample papers, we are providing the students with an approximate weightage that is carried by each chapter. 

Topic

Expected Weightage (Marks)

Key Concepts

Force, Work, Power, and Energy

16-19 Marks

Laws of motion, types of forces, concepts of work, power, and energy, conservation of energy

Light

20-25 Marks

Reflection, refraction, lenses, optical instruments

Sound

11-18 Marks

Nature of sound waves, characteristics, resonance, musical instruments

Electricity and Magnetism

20-21 Marks

Electric circuits, Ohm’s law, magnetic fields, electromagnetism, electromagnetic induction

Heat

14-18 Marks

Thermal expansion, temperature scales, specific heat capacity, latent heat

Modern Physics

7-11 Marks

Atomic structure, radioactivity, basic concepts of fission and fusion, applications of radioactivity

ICSE Class 10 Physics Question Paper Format 2025

Section

Type of Questions

Number of Questions

Marks per Question

Total Marks

Section A

Short-Answer Questions (Compulsory)

Varies

1–2 marks each

40 marks

Section B

Long-Answer Questions (Choice-Based)

4 out of 6 questions

10 marks each

40 marks

  • Total Marks for Theory: 80
  • Total Marks for Internal Assessment (Practical Work): 20
  • Overall Total Marks: 100

The Internal Assessment component is graded out of 20 marks, based on lab work, practical files, and viva, which assesses a student's hands-on skills and understanding of experiments.

ICSE Class 10 Physics Exam Pattern 2025

The Theory Paper will be for two hours. The total marks are 80. The paper will be divided into two sections: 

Section A: Section A is a compulsory section with short-answer questions, covering all chapters in the syllabus.

Section B: Section B will have a choice-based section with detailed questions, allowing students to select which questions to answer.

Each section is structured to assess different levels of understanding and application in physics. 

The Internal Assessment will be 20 marks and will be based on the following components:

  • Laboratory work (Conducting experiments for which instructions will be given)
  • Viva Voce
